Calipo Theatre Co Presents PINEAPPLE, May 5-6, May 11-14

By: Mar. 29, 2011

Roxanna is only interested in herself, boys and Barcardi Breezers. Her sister Paula lives for others - her kids, her friends, and Roxanna - her family. In her tumble down flat in Ballymun, Paula is in control; but when the unknown shows up at her door, everything changes. Can Paula take a chance on love, or will she always sacrifice her own happiness for others?

PINEAPPLE is a tough and tender drama about love and survival featuring, Caoilfhionn Dunne, Janet Moran, Nick Lee, Jill Murphy and Niamh Glynn.

Calipo Theatre Company presents the world premiere of PINEAPPLE, the new play from acclaimed playwright Phillip McMahon (Danny & Chantelle, All over Town, Alice In Funderland).

Directed by David Horan

Set Design by Paul O'Mahony

Lighting Design by Sinead Mckenna

Sound Design by Ivan Birthistle & Vincent Doherty
